Tamás Vető ( Budapest, 1935) is a Hungarian-born Danish choral and opera conductor. He trained at the Budapest Conservatoire, then studied in France under Nadia Boulanger. He came to Denmark in 1957. [1] He conducted Wagner's Der Ring des Niebelungen at the National Danish Opera in 1996. From 1996 to 2000 he was chief conductor of the vocal group Ars Nova Copenhagen. [2]
